Importance of Nutritious Foods



To maintain healthy and balanced teeth in kids, prioritize incorporating nutrient-rich foods into their diet plan. Foods such as fruits, vegetables, dairy items, lean proteins, and whole grains are vital for promoting oral health and wellness. These foods provide crucial nutrients like calcium, vitamin C, and phosphorus, which strengthen teeth and assist prevent dental caries.

Encourage your youngster to treat on crunchy vegetables and fruits like apples, carrots, and celery, as their appearance can help tidy teeth naturally.

In addition to vegetables and fruits, dairy items like yogurt and cheese are outstanding choices for your youngster's dental health. Dairy products are rich in calcium and phosphorus, which are essential for remineralizing tooth enamel and keeping teeth strong. Lean proteins such as fowl, fish, and eggs likewise contribute in maintaining healthy and balanced teeth by giving necessary nutrients for tooth development.

Foods to Avoid for Dental Health



Steer clear of sugary treats and drinks to preserve optimal dental health and wellness in kids. Foods high in sugar can add to dental cavity and cavities. Candies, soft drinks, fruit juices with sugarcoated, and sugary treats like cookies and cakes should be limited in your kid's diet regimen. These sweet deals with can produce an acidic setting in the mouth, bring about disintegration of tooth enamel and the formation of tooth cavities over time.

In addition, starchy foods like chips and crackers can likewise hurt oral health and wellness. These foods often tend to obtain embeded between teeth, offering a breeding place for damaging bacteria that trigger decay. Staying clear of extreme usage of these starchy snacks can assist avoid oral issues.

Furthermore, acidic foods and beverages like citrus fruits, vinegar-based dressings, and soft drinks can damage tooth enamel, making teeth much more vulnerable to decay. Restricting the consumption of these acidic items can guard your youngster's dental health. By being mindful of the foods to avoid, you can promote solid and healthy teeth in your youngsters.
